The postcode L13 2AU is located in Liverpool, in the county of Merseyside. It was introduced in January 1980 and is an active postcode. L13 2AU is a small user postcode that may contain upto 100 addresses (but 15 is more typical).

L13 2AU is one of the most deprived areas in the country. It rates as a 0.2 on the scale of the index of deprivation (where 10 are the least deprived and 0 are the most deprived areas). The 2011 UK census classified the residents of L13 2AU as Multicultural metropolitans > Rented family living > Social renting young families.

The closest road name to L13 2AU is Ennismore Road which is centered 47 m away.

The nearest bus stop is Cheadle Avenue and is 213 m away. The closest railway station is Wavertree Technology Park Rail Station, 866 m away.

The closest primary school to L13 2AU (for ages 11 and under) is St Cuthbert's Catholic Primary and Nursery School. It achieved an OFSTED rating of Good on November 16, 2017. The closest secondary school (for ages 11-18) is Dixons Broadgreen Academy.

The local pub for residents of L13 2AU is Carrickfergus Cricket Club - Bar and is 1.99 km away. The Food Standards Agency (FSA) rated it as Very Good on October 14, 2020. The nearest takeaway food is available from Milestone Chippy and is 1.99 km distant. The FSA rated this establishment as Very Good on November 18, 2020.

Residents reported an average download speed of 142.9 Mbps and an average upload speed of 12.9 Mbps in a 2017 OFCOM broadband survey. 93.3% of residents have broadband access of ultrafast 300+ Mbps. 100% of residents have broadband access of superfast 30-300 Mbps.

Gas consumption for the area is rated at 2.8 out of 10. Electricity consumption for the area is rated at 0.5 out of 10. Where 0 are the lowest and 10 are the highest consuming areas in the country respectively.

Policing for L13 2AU is covered by the Merseyside police force association and Liverpool is the NHS Primary Care Trust (PCT) or Care Trust Plus (CT).
